What are the predictions for inflation?
Predicting inflation is a very important task for Economists. Future forecasts of inflation are used to determine current monetary policy. If inflation predictions are wrong it can cause inappropriate monetary policy, resulting in either inflation or recession.

What is the true rate of inflation?
Inflation Rate The inflation rate is the percentage increase or decrease in prices during a specified period, usually a month or a year. The percentage tells you how quickly prices rose during the period. For example, if the inflation rate for a gallon of gas is 2% per year, then gas prices will be 2% higher next year.

A Note to Users of Data from the Philadelphia Fed’s
May 28, 2021 · • Long-Term CPI Inflation. In the survey of 2005:Q3, we added forecasts for the five-year annual-average rate of headline CPI inflation (CPI5YR). We also extended the forecast horizon one year for fourth-quarter over fourth-quarter headline CPI inflation. • Short-Term CPI and PCE Inflation. In the survey of 2007:Q1, we added forecasts
